Quality Control Analyst
Job descriptions & requirements
Main Responsibilities
- Taking and analyzing samples from all stages of manufacturing to ensure they meet project standards.
- Testing raw materials, in-process materials, and finished pharmaceutical products to ensure they meet the established specifications.
- Ensure that experiments are completed according to established Standard Operating Practices (SOPs), and also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P).
- Minor equipment troubleshooting, calibration and repair.
- Report laboratory findings in technical documents and laboratory report sheets.
- Assisting in defining assay criteria and drafting standard operating procedures.
- Review laboratory test outcomes, comparing them with set criteria and advising on whether results are suitable for release.
- Keeping laboratory instruments and equipment in good working condition.
- Keeping track of instruments and equipment routine maintenance.
- Conducting quality control checks throughout the production process.
- Applicant should possess a B. SC or HND in Chemistry, Biochemistry, Microbiology, Science Laboratory Technology (Chemistry or Microbiology option)
- Candidate should have 1-3 years experience in pharmaceutical manufacturing/ manufacturing industry.
